On Fri, Nov 29, 2013 at 06:37:35PM +0900, Alexandre Courbot wrote:
> On Fri, Nov 29, 2013 at 6:16 PM, Heikki Krogerus
> > diff --git a/drivers/gpio/gpiolib.c b/drivers/gpio/gpiolib.c
> > index 4e10b10..2f0305e 100644
> > --- a/drivers/gpio/gpiolib.c
> > +++ b/drivers/gpio/gpiolib.c
> > @@ -2434,10 +2434,8 @@ struct gpio_desc *__must_check 
> > gpiod_get_index(struct device *dev,
> >                 desc = gpiod_find(dev, con_id, idx, &flags);
> >         }
> >
> > -       if (IS_ERR(desc)) {
> > -               dev_warn(dev, "lookup for GPIO %s failed\n", con_id);
> > +       if (IS_ERR(desc))
> >                 return desc;
> > -       }
> >
> >         status = gpiod_request(desc, con_id);
> 
> I kind of agree with the logic that motivates this patch, but how
> about turning this warning into dev_dbg() instead so that people who
> wish so can still continue using it?

Sure, I'll send v2 of this and do just that.
